The rover caching Mars samples for return to Earth - and the one that carried the first helicopter to fly on another planet.

Specs

1,025 kg dry mass; landed 18 Feb 2021 in Jezero Crater (an ancient river delta); Ingenuity's first powered flight 19 Apr 2021; Ingenuity completed 72 flights.

Why it matters

Powered, controlled flight in a thin atmosphere 225 million km away - flight dynamics working exactly as physics predicts, on another world.
